Compartilhar via


PerformanceCounter.InstanceLifetime Propriedade

Definição

Obtém ou define o tempo de vida de um processo.

public:
 property System::Diagnostics::PerformanceCounterInstanceLifetime InstanceLifetime { System::Diagnostics::PerformanceCounterInstanceLifetime get(); void set(System::Diagnostics::PerformanceCounterInstanceLifetime value); };
public System.Diagnostics.PerformanceCounterInstanceLifetime InstanceLifetime { get; set; }
member this.InstanceLifetime : System.Diagnostics.PerformanceCounterInstanceLifetime with get, set
Public Property InstanceLifetime As PerformanceCounterInstanceLifetime

Valor da propriedade

Um dos PerformanceCounterInstanceLifetime valores. O padrão é Global.

Exceções

O conjunto de valores não é um membro da PerformanceCounterInstanceLifetime enumeração.

InstanceLifetime é definido após a PerformanceCounter inicialização.

Comentários

Se a categoria do contador de desempenho for criada com o .NET Framework versão 1.0 ou 1.1, ele usará memória compartilhada global e o valor deve InstanceLifetime ser Global. Se a categoria não for usada por aplicativos em execução nas versões 1.0 ou 1.1 do .NET Framework, exclua e recrie a categoria.

Observação

Se o valor da CounterType propriedade for SingleInstance, o InstanceLifetime valor do contador de desempenho deverá ser Global.

Aplica-se a